The Orenplatte rises 800 meters above the Glarus valley floor. At its center, a circular wooden stage forms a architectural landmark. The six-meter platform, slightly elevated and paired with a folding counterpart, functions both as an open platform and as an acoustically protected space. It serves many roles: a resting spot, a picnic place, a playground, a meeting point — and a stage for concerts of the highest quality.
Built from local spruce, the stage features rough-sawn surfaces sealed with silicate paint. This treatment protects the structure and highlights its sculptural, abstract character. For unamplified performances, the foldable back wall (45°–90°) directs sound toward the audience. Overlapping cladding boards scatter sound waves, creating a natural and full acoustic experience.
